The document presents case studies of three housing projects: Belapur Housing in Navi Mumbai, Aranya Slum Rehabilitation in Indore, and Poonthura Fishermen’s Village in Kerala, each focusing on socio-economic upliftment and environmental sustainability. Key features include community participation, adaptive reuse of structures, and climate-responsive designs tailored to local needs. The projects emphasize the importance of public spaces and street typology in fostering social cohesion and community engagement.
